What Does a Divorce Paralegal Do?
A family legal assistant plays a vital part in supporting legal counsel handling divorce proceedings. They usually prepare paperwork, which encompass motions, financial affidavits , and information requests . Their responsibilities also commonly involve interacting with individuals, opposing counsel , and the court . Furthermore, a skilled divorce legal professional can manage records , arrange meetings, and perform preliminary legal research . They are a essential part of the litigation support staff and enable attorneys to productively address their workload.
Paralegal Divorce: Advantages & When You Require One
Navigating a divorce can be overwhelming , especially when complex financial issues are involved. Engaging a paralegal specializing in divorce cases can provide significant support at a reduced cost than an established attorney. Paralegals are able to assist with tasks such as paperwork preparation, information gathering , coordinating appointments , and court research. You should think about a paralegal's help if your divorce appears uncontested and you wish to lower court costs . However, it is crucial to remember that paralegals cannot provide official advice and must operate under the supervision of an attorney.
